Underdogs Triumph in a Spectacular Showdown

In a remarkable display of skill and determination, 1. FC Saarbrücken continues their miraculous run in the DFB-Pokal, securing a spot in the quarterfinals after a thrilling victory over Eintracht Frankfurt. The 3. Liga team, known for its resilience and spirited play, has once again proven that in football, David can indeed defeat Goliath.

1. FC Saarbrücken: A Rich History of Defying Odds

Founded in 1903, Saarbrücken has a storied past, with notable achievements including a semi-final appearance in the DFB-Pokal as a fourth-tier team in 2020 and a historic win against FC Bayern Munich in November 2023. With a current standing of 5th in the 3. Liga, Saarbrücken is no stranger to overcoming challenges, exemplified by their journey to first division play in the Gauliga Südwest during the Nazi era and their remarkable recovery post World War II in the Oberliga Südwest-Nord​.

Eintracht Frankfurt: A Formidable Opponent

Eintracht Frankfurt, a Bundesliga mainstay founded in 1899, has a rich heritage in German football. Known for their passionate fan base and impressive attendance records, Frankfurt has had its share of highs and lows. Despite a history of fluctuating league performances, their recent accomplishments include a UEFA Europa League win in 2022 and reaching the DFB-Pokal final in 2023​.

The Match: A Test of Strategy and Skill

The match at Ludwigsparkstadion, home to Saarbrücken, witnessed a gripping first half, leading to a decisive second half where Saarbrücken’s Kai Brünker and Lucas Kerber scored the winning goals. The match also saw a red card for Saarbrücken’s Noel Futkeu, adding to the game’s intensity​​.

Key Players in the Spotlight

Kai Brünker, pivotal in Saarbrücken’s attack, and Lucas Kerber, known for their on-field chemistry, were instrumental in securing the victory. Saarbrücken’s squad, boasting talents like Tim Schreiber and Patrick Sontheimer, showcases a blend of experience and youthful exuberance​​.

Eintracht Frankfurt, led by their captain Sebastian Rode, fielded a strong lineup including Kevin Trapp and Mario Götze, players with significant international experience. Their diverse team composition reflects the club’s strategic player acquisitions and development​.
